ASSAM
Following are some of the places to visit in Assam, Northeast India
Guwahati:
Guwahati is the largest city of Assam, a major riverine port city and one of the fastest growing cities in India.
Kaziranga National Park:
Kaziranga National Park is a national park in the Golaghat and Nagaon districts of the state of Assam, India.
The sanctuary, which hosts two-thirds of the world’s great one-horned rhinoceroses is a World Heritage Site.
Kamakhya Temple:
The Kamakhya Temple; also Kamrup-Kamakhya is a Hindu temple dedicated to the mother goddess Kamakhya.
It is one of the oldest of the 51 Shakti Pithas.
Majuli Islands:
Majuli is a large river island in the Brahmaputra River, Assam, India.
The island had a total area of 1,250 square kilometres but having lost significantly to erosion it had an area of only 352 square kilometres in 2014.[2]Majuli has shrunk as the river surrounding it has grown.
